Barolo Riserva Runcot 2007 Elio Grasso

Barolo "Runcot" Riserva 2007 is a fine Piedmontese wine produced by Elio Grasso. It is the company's symbolic label, produced from Nebbiolo grapes harvested in the Monforte d'Alba area, only in the most favourable vintages.

The grapes come from vineyards that are 30 years old and after careful selection, they ferment in steel and then mature in French oak barriques for 60 months, plus another year in the bottle.

The Barolo Riserva Runcot di Elio Grasso shows a ruby red colour with garnet reflections; on the nose it expresses a complex bouquet of sweet spices, ripe red fruit, hints of underbrush, balsamic and mineral notes.

DENOMINATION: Barolo DOCG

REGION: Piedmont (Italy)

GRAPES: 100% Nebbiolo

VINIFICATION: fermentation in steel tanks at controlled temperature, complete malolactic fermentation in wooden barrels, ageing for 60 months in oak barrels

ELIO GRASSO

In Monforte d'Alba stands the estate of Elio Grasso, one of the most important names in the Piedmontese wine scene of the Langhe. Care for every minimum production step and respect in the terroir are the key points of Grasso's production, which allow to give life to pure and expressive wines.
